Position Summary

• The supply chain business analyst will work collaboratively with the supply chain product managers, supply chain engineers, and the operational teams to develop reporting, dashboarding, and analytical solutions to ad-hoc supply chain problems.
• This role can tell stories with data and simplify and present the relevant information to help our supply chain operations teams make informed, data-driven solutions.
• This includes but is not limited to the development of robust reports and operational playbook to drive incremental value in business stakeholder conversations and vendor negotiations.
• Develop business models and assumptions for financial models and analysis to unlock value. Provide recommendations based on data and provide options to inform leadership decision making.

Principle Duties & Responsibilities
• Drives relationships with multiple stakeholders to define metrics and create operational performance reporting and dashboarding for supply chain teams.
• Represents supply chain through all internal collaborative channels as the data expert for the supply chain analytics reporting environment and help users create dashboards and reporting for their business need
• Mentor Supply Chain COOPs by providing project oversight, guidance, and development
• Leads the development and execution of training, support, and troubleshooting for analytics environment
• Leads the retrieval and quality control of data related to financial, merchandising, shopper marketing, e-commerce, and supply chain revenue to ensure the data accuracy.
• Builds the supporting business process for analytical support, dashboard maintenance and reports to identify business opportunities to unlock the values
• Collaborate closely with the strategy group and key cross-functional leadership to support decisions and evaluate potential strategic opportunities, with a focus on providing recommendations on improvement for strategic tests and initiatives underway.
• Leads the partnership with finance and IT and relevant leaders to develop meaningful assumptions for financial models (including any pro forma investment models) regarding impacts of major strategic initiatives
• Develop presentations utilized to communicate meaningful results, trends, and insights regarding the performance of key strategic initiatives.
• Drives strategic projects, creating structure around ambiguous strategic questions, analyzing complex business problems, and developing data driven insights to support a solution
• Lead and engage in discussions with leadership about innovative approaches to analysis and the implications of different data, while building alignment on the results.
• Supports overall IT relationships, budgeting process, prioritization, and resource allocation in collaboration with IT leads and analytics product managers
